What a fun day and did we luck out on the weather! Twelve BARC members enjoyed a beautiful day at John Bryan State Park last Saturday for the first annual Fall Field Day. We arrived early, set up our antennas and radios, and were on the air at 10 am. Several members got to test out various homemade or purchased antenna configurations during the day. Tom McClory, KE8FWZ, took the prize with the most contacts followed by Rob DeSonia, WS8M. Overall, BARC members made 99 contacts with 36 different Ohio State Parks scoring 3564 points.
